Super Eagles defender Emmanuel Fernandez has emerged as a transfer target for Bundesliga side Bayer Leverkusen ahead of a potential move from Rangers before the end of the transfer window, Afrik-Foot reports.
The 25-year-old has been the subject of intense transfer speculation this summer following an impressive campaign with the Scottish giants last season.
Fernandez was an integral part of the Rangers team throughout the campaign. Although the club ultimately fell short in the title race after losing out to Celtic, the Nigerian defender enjoyed an outstanding individual season.
His performances earned him the Rangers Player of the Season award, while he was also named in the PFA Scotland Team of the Season.

That impressive form has attracted interest from several clubs across Europe, including Premier League giants Arsenal and Chelsea, as well as French side Rennes and Borussia Dortmund.
West Ham United and Bayer Leverkusen have now joined the race as they look to strengthen their squads ahead of the new season.
Why Bayer Leverkusen are keen on Emmanuel Fernandez
According to Onefootball, Bayer Leverkusen are interested in reaching an agreement for Emmanuel Fernandez this summer despite competition from several clubs.
The German side are looking to make a strong start to the new Bundesliga campaign as they aim to challenge Bayern Munich for the league title.
One major reason behind Leverkusen’s interest in Fernandez is their need for more options in defence. The Bundesliga side are looking to strengthen their backline ahead of the new season, and Fernandez has emerged as one of the players they believe could improve their defensive options.

Leverkusen have already brought in Facundo Medina from Lens, but the Argentine defender has played as a left-back rather than a centre-back in recent times.
That means Leverkusen could still need another reliable option in central defence, and Fernandez’s profile makes him an attractive candidate.
The Super Eagles defender has shown that he has the quality to compete at a higher level, while his aerial ability, physical presence and defensive solidity could make him a good fit for the Bundesliga side.
Another factor that could be behind Leverkusen’s interest is Fernandez’s ability to play out from the back.
The Nigerian defender is comfortable in possession and has shown that he can help his team build attacks from defence rather than simply relying on long clearances.
His high passing accuracy is another positive, while he is also capable of switching play with long passes when the situation requires it. Those qualities could make Fernandez particularly attractive to Leverkusen, who value defenders capable of contributing to their possession-based style of football.
However, any potential move will depend on Leverkusen meeting Rangers’ valuation of the defender.

A deal could surpass Rangers’ record sale and make Fernandez the most expensive player to leave the Scottish club in their history.
With the transfer window still open and more movement expected before the deadline, Fernandez could yet leave Rangers for the next chapter of his career, with Bayer Leverkusen among the clubs monitoring his situation.
